Aurorasound VIDA Mk.II Vinyl Disk Amplifier
After 10 years on the market Karaki-san released a new, improved version of his outstanding, highly praised phono stage - the Aurorasound VIDA Mk.II.
The exterior design has not changed much. Internal circuit, PCB, PSU, specifications and sonic performance have been refined. Among other things the L/R channel separation improved +6dB, THD+N factor improved from 0.028% to 0.012%, new amp modules (gold-plated, developed for the VIDA Supreme), inputs for 2 MC or 2 MM cartridges at the same time (or 1 each) and the US version now comes standard with a 6 position impedance selector switch for MC on the backside.

Precision DC circuit with the latest semiconductor technology...
...eliminated all capacitors in the signal path. It enabled a completely flat frequency response without any coloration across the entire audible range. The active DC servo circuit permits absolutely stable outputs regardless of fluctuations in the inputs and operating temperature. Especially, resolution and distortion in low frequency are improved significantly, therefore, you will be able to even sense and feel the atmosphere of the music hall, performers and the staging. The power supply uses toroid transformer, Schottky barrier diode which allows ultra-low noise. Any leakage flux noises are completely eliminated with use of a separate power supply by employing high-speed semiconductor-based stable power supply circuit.
LCR Type RIAA device...
Unlike conventional NF and CR type, an ideal circuit design with constant impedance LCR-type RIAA circuit is used. As a result, across the entire frequency range, RIAA curve correction is achieved with constant condition. In the past, vacuum tubes were used with a large chassis, but VIDA managed in a compact size thanks to the latest semiconductor technologies. Each component is placed according to the signal flow in symmetrical and the shortest route. The equalizer circuit uses the renowned Swedish Lundahl filter-coil, which is widely used in the professional equipment, for turnover and roll-off independently.
Small signals recorded on the vinyl disc must be precisely restored to a flat response using (L) coil and CR network circuit, which go through the RIAA curve having attenuated lows and boosted highs. At the same time, it must be amplified by roughly 1,600 times (In case of MC cartridges). Since amplification is very large, any noises from the power supply and the circuits must be reduced to the possible minimum. VIDA managed to achieve very high S/N ratio due to a careful selection of the components, circuit design and PC board pattern configurations.
